Changbai Mountain Tianchi Lake is shrouded in clouds and mist at its summit.
This is the backbone of Northeast China, with magnificent scenery, but after a while, it can become somewhat monotonous and boring.
A figure darted swiftly along the steep mountain ridge, his feet barely touching the ground. The treacherous mountain paths that would require ordinary tourists to use both hands and feet were like flat ground under his feet.
Ding Shian carried a huge hiking backpack, his breathing was steady, and not a single drop of sweat appeared on his forehead.
"It's the fifth day."
Ding Shian looked up at the mountaintop that was so close at hand and sighed silently in his heart.
Who would have thought that he, a man of extraordinary talent who aspired to challenge the strongest in the world, would be reduced to a "nanny" who delivers takeout these past few days?
Ding Shian's backpack didn't contain any magical weapons, but rather instant bread, sausages, and several large bottles of mineral water that he bought at a supermarket in the town at the foot of the mountain.
Ever since that day when he dealt with Minamoto no Yoshitsune and his gang, Kotomori has been living on the altar like a statue.
Aside from the necessary eating, drinking, and relieving himself, this kid never moved an inch from his spot, keeping his eyes closed all day. In his own words, he was "combing the earth's veins."
Ding Shian exerted force with his feet, leaped forward, and landed steadily on the open ground beside Tianchi Lake.
In the distance, the boy in casual clothes was still sitting cross-legged on the protruding bluestone.
Out of curiosity, Ding Shian had pestered Yan Sen a couple of days ago to open the All-Seeing Eye again so that he could also witness the so-called "sorting out the earth's veins" process.
Yan Sen didn't hold back either, generously giving him a "VIP view" and adjusting the "quality" from 480P to Blu-ray 4K.
That one glance was enough to make Ding Shian completely calm down and willingly become Yan Sen's meal deliveryman.
In his view, Yan Sen at that time seemed to no longer be a person.
He is like a huge hub connecting heaven and earth.
The intricate network of ley lines beneath Changbai Mountain, as vast as the blood vessels of the human body, is undergoing a breathtaking "blood transfusion" centered on Yan Sen.
Countless streams of filthy, cold, and putrid black energy flowed continuously into Yan Sen's body along the earth's veins.
The scene was like a hundred rivers flowing into one, or like ten thousand ghosts devouring one's body.
Having walked the world of supernatural beings for so many years, Ding Shian had seen many supernatural beings who specialized in feng shui, and he also knew a little about what the so-called "earthly evil" in feng shui was.
The tangible black energy that Yan Sen absorbed would have been enough to cause an ordinary feng shui master to suffer a qi deviation and never make any further progress in their cultivation if they had only been slightly exposed to it.
What about Ke Yansen?
He acted as if nothing had happened, his thin body seemingly a bottomless pit, accepting all who came. The black energy entered his body, and after being circulated through his domineering methods, when it was exhaled, it had transformed into pure, warm earth energy radiating a faint golden light, returning to the earth.
Ding Shian stared at that retreating figure with a complex expression.
He was a martial arts fanatic, pursuing the ultimate power of the individual. Yan Sen's methods, however, had transcended the realm of "technique" and were more like fulfilling a "divine duty," a true "way."
Hey, speaking of which, Brother Yan Sen really trusts him. If Ding Shian had such abilities, he wouldn't show them to others so easily.
Ding Shian shook his head, trying to clear his mind of the jumbled thoughts. He walked to a large, sheltered rock not far from Yan Sen, put down his backpack, unzipped it, took out a bag of red bean bread, tore open the packaging, and took a big bite.
Cheap bread melts in your mouth when you chew it; the texture and taste are rather ordinary, but it can fill your stomach.
"There are advantages to being a lone wolf. One person is full, and the whole family isn't hungry," Ding Shian mumbled indistinctly, unscrewing the bottle of mineral water and taking a sip. "Being a nanny is worthwhile; it's a contribution to this land."
Just as Ding Shian swallowed half a loaf of bread.
On the altar, Yan Sen, who had been standing like a statue, suddenly moved.
"call--"
Yan Sen let out a long breath.
The breath, though condensed, transformed into a white streak in the air, shooting three meters away and striking the rock with a soft "crack".
Yan Sen slowly opened his eyes, his originally bluish-gold pupils gradually returning to clear black and white. He stretched his stiff neck, and his joints crackled and popped.
"Oh my god... my back is about to break."
Yan Sen rubbed his lower back, stood up with a grimacing expression, and without any air of superiority, dusted off the dirt on his buttocks. Then, sniffing the air, he strolled straight toward Ding Shian like a cat smelling fish.
Ding Shian looked at Yan Sen as he walked over and handed him the water bottle: "All done?"
"Okay, all done."
Yan Sen didn't stand on ceremony. He took the water bottle, tilted his head back, and took a big gulp. Then, quite naturally, he squatted down next to Ding Shian and started rummaging through the backpack.
"Tsk, red bean bread again? Brother Ding, can't you change it up? Pork floss would be fine too." Yan Sen complained as he tore open the packaging and wolfed it down. "My mouth has been so bland these past few days."
Ding Shian looked at Yan Sen, who had no manners at all, and the corners of his mouth turned up slightly.
Who would have thought that the boy who was just now exhaling the evil energy of heaven and earth, like a god, is now like a high school student who skipped class and came back from an all-night internet cafe.
"How was today? Did it go smoothly?" Ding Shian asked.
"That's about it." Yan Sen swallowed the bread in his mouth and said indistinctly, "These little devils really put in a lot of effort. The number of evil energy nails they buried is not only large, but they are also hidden very deep. Even for me, it will take some effort to pull them all out."
Although Yan Sen spoke casually, Ding Shian could see a subtle weariness hidden deep in his eyes.
"Brother Ding."
Yan Sen finished his bread in a few bites, casually stuffed the bag into his pocket, turned to look at Ding Shian, and the laziness in his eyes lessened slightly. "How are you feeling? After you finish eating, how about giving your brother a hand?"
Upon hearing this, Ding Shian paused slightly in the hand holding the water bottle.
He looked at Yan Sen, but didn't agree immediately. Instead, he asked seriously, "Are you in good shape? I'm not in a hurry. My personal desires are insignificant compared to the creatures of Changbai Mountain. I can wait until you've rested."
This is Ding Shian's "sincerity".
He did want to test his skills against unfamiliar methods and become stronger, but he didn't want to take advantage of others' misfortunes.
"Hey, it's nothing." Yan Sen waved his hand, looking nonchalant. "I've already taken care of most of what I could handle. The rest can be left to the ley lines to recover on their own. Luckily we arrived early. If we had waited until the Japanese finished their ceremony, cleared the mountains and forests, and completely changed the terrain, that would have been a real problem."
Yan Sen stood up, stretched, and looked at the calm surface of Tianchi Lake with a smile on his lips.
"Besides, I need to stretch my muscles. Sitting around all these days has made my bones rust." Yan Sen turned around, his gaze fixed intently on Ding Shian. "Furthermore, after fulfilling my promise to you, Brother Ding, I have to go to Tianjin. Xu Laosi and Feng Baobao are waiting for me; I can't keep them waiting too long, can I?"
After hearing this, Ding Shian stopped being coy.
He stuffed the last bite of bread into his mouth, patted the crumbs off his hands, and slowly stood up.
"That would be perfect."
Ding Shian's expression changed.
If he was like a dutiful "nanny" just now, then at this moment Ding Shian is like a boxer about to step into the ring.
Every cell in his body was cheering; a fervent fighting spirit from the depths of his soul flowed in his eyes like a volcano about to erupt.
"To be honest, I'm starting to feel restless too."
The two exchanged a glance and, with remarkable tacit understanding, refrained from making a move immediately.
They each found a flat rock, sat cross-legged, and closed their eyes to regulate their breathing.
A gentle breeze ripples across the surface of Tianchi Lake.
half an hour.
The two opened their eyes almost simultaneously.
Their eyes met, and sparks seemed to crackle in the air.
Yan Sen was the first to stand up. He didn't rush to assume a defensive stance, but instead raised his right foot and gently stomped on the ground.
"Buzz—"
An invisible wave spread out along the earth's veins.
He set up a simple "hidden Qi formation".
This fluctuation can completely lock down the aura within a radius of 100 meters, preventing the two from making too much noise and attracting the attention of the scenic area staff or other unnecessary trouble.
After doing all this, Yan Sen put his hands in his pockets and looked at Ding Shian with a smile: "Brother Ding, please."
Ding Shian took a deep breath and did not rush to launch an attack.
He reached into his robe and pulled out a black cloth bag.
The cloth bag was unfolded, revealing several steel needles, each a few inches long and gleaming with a cold, silvery light, neatly inserted inside.
"This is a needle for the dead."
Ding Shian picked up a steel needle, his tone tinged with nostalgia and respect, "It's used to seal acupoints; it can save lives, or it can kill. It was passed down to me by an old man surnamed Bi."
"Old Master Bi?" Yan Sen raised an eyebrow; that's a rare surname.
"Yes, his name is Bi Yuan," Ding Shian explained. "He was my mentor on the path of Qi cultivation. In fact, it wouldn't be an exaggeration for me to call him Master. This skill emphasizes the flow of Qi through the meridians and requires acupuncture according to the Eight Methods of the Spirit Turtle."
As he spoke, Ding Shian held several Ghost Needles between his fingers, lowered his body slightly, and assumed a stance that balanced offense and defense. "I will go all out, and I hope you won't hold back either. Let me witness your wondrous skills!"
Upon hearing this, Yan Sen's smile gradually widened, eventually transforming into an arrogant expression completely different from his usual demeanor.
"Then let's go, Brother Ding."
Yan Sen's eyes flashed with a blue-gold light, and his clothes moved without any wind.
"As the saying goes, 'Eating from a hundred families will surely make you popular, and learning a hundred skills will surely make you a good talent.' I, your younger brother, also want to give it a try. Just how good are you, Brother Ding?"
Before the words were finished, two completely different streams of Qi suddenly erupted at the edge of Tianchi Lake.
One is as heavy as a mountain, the other as sharp as a sword.
The two forces collided in the air, stirring up dust on the ground, which spiraled up like an earthen dragon.
"Come!"
Yan Sen gave a soft shout, showing no intention of testing anyone, and immediately launched a killing move.
He pressed his right hand down in the air, and a golden light, yellowish-brown in color, suddenly appeared in his palm.
Spleen Earth Metal Light - Heavy Pressure.
"boom--!"
Ding Shian felt as if a piece of the sky above him had collapsed.
A terrifying gravitational force, enough to crush an ordinary superhuman, descended upon him without warning.
There was no buffer, and no room to dodge.
"Snap!"
The rock beneath Ding Shian's feet instantly crumbled, and his feet were pressed into the ground as if nails, all the way up to his ankles!
However, facing this overwhelming pressure, Ding Shian showed no pain whatsoever; instead, he revealed an extremely excited and maniacal laugh.
"good!!!"
Ding Shian roared, his muscles bulged, and a layer of dazzling, glass-like light instantly covered his entire body, forcefully resisting the gravity.
"Not enough! Still not enough! Little brother! Give it your all!"
Under immense pressure, Ding Shian pulled his feet out of the ground step by step, his fighting spirit burning to its fullest extent.
